Worried about a screeching sound from your car? It might be your alternator bearing.

If your alternator bearing is going bad, you'll likely hear a screeching or whining noise when you start your car. This noise will get worse as you accelerate, and it may even cause your car to stall. A faulty alternator bearing can also lead to other problems, such as a loss of power steering or brakes. In severe cases, it can even cause your engine to seize up.

How to Change an Alternator Bearing

If you're hearing a screeching or whining noise from your car, it's important to have your alternator bearing checked by a mechanic. If the bearing is bad, it will need to be replaced. Here's how to do it:

  1. Disconnect the battery. This will prevent you from getting shocked when you're working on the alternator.
  2. Remove the alternator belt. This will give you access to the alternator.
  3. Unbolt the alternator. There are usually two or three bolts that hold the alternator in place.
  4. Pull the alternator off the engine. Be careful not to drop it.
  5. Remove the bearing from the alternator. The bearing is usually held in place by a snap ring. Use a screwdriver to pry the snap ring off, and then pull the bearing out.
  6. Install the new bearing. Put the new bearing in place and secure it with the snap ring.
  7. Reinstall the alternator. Bolt the alternator back onto the engine, and then put the belt back on.
  8. Reconnect the battery. Start your car and check for the screeching or whining noise. If it's gone, then you've successfully replaced the alternator bearing.

How to Change an Alternator Bearing: A Comprehensive Guide

Identifying the Need for Bearing Replacement

  • Dimming Headlights or Flickering Dashboard Lights: A failing alternator bearing can cause inadequate power supply, resulting in dimmed lights.
  • Squealing or Grinding Noises: Worn bearings produce a high-pitched squeal or a grinding sound when the alternator is engaged.
  • Overheating or Battery Draining: Excessive bearing friction can cause overheating and battery drainage.

Tools and Materials Required

  • New alternator bearing
  • Socket wrench set
  • Pulley puller
  • Bearing press or hammer and punch
  • Grease

Safety Precautions

  • Disconnect the battery before starting any work.
  • Allow the engine to cool completely to avoid burns.
  • Wear gloves and safety glasses for protection.

Removing the Alternator Bearing

  1. Disconnect the Alternator: Remove the negative battery terminal and any electrical connectors from the alternator.
  2. Unbolt the Alternator: Use a socket wrench to loosen the mounting bolts and remove the alternator from the vehicle.
  3. Remove the Pulley: Secure the pulley with a pulley puller and apply force to remove it from the shaft.

Installing the New Bearing

  1. Remove the Old Bearing: Use a bearing press or a hammer and punch to carefully remove the old bearing from the alternator housing.
  2. Grease the New Bearing: Apply a thin layer of grease to the inner and outer surfaces of the new bearing.
  3. Install the New Bearing: Press the new bearing into place using a bearing press or carefully tap it in with a hammer and a punch.

Reassembling the Alternator

  1. Reinstall the Pulley: Place the pulley back on the shaft and securely tighten it with a pulley puller.
  2. Bolt Back Alternator: Position the alternator back on the vehicle and tighten the mounting bolts to the specified torque.
  3. Reconnect Electrical Connectors: Reattach the electrical connectors and the negative battery terminal.

Testing the Alternator

  • Start the Engine: Start the vehicle and let it run for a few minutes.
  • Check Electrical System: Observe the headlights and dashboard lights for proper brightness.
  • Listen for Noises: Ensure that there are no squealing or grinding noises coming from the alternator.
